Managing secure access to applications has never been more important, especially as global users interact with your services from different locations. Region-aware access controls paired with step-up authentication offer an effective way to ensure that only the right users, in acceptable regions, gain access while meeting security and compliance requirements. Let's break down what this is, why it matters, and how to implement it.
What is Region-Aware Access Control?
Region-aware access control evaluates the geographic location of a user before granting or restricting access to a system or resource. This technique ensures users logged in from allowed regions can access your platform while denying or challenging those in restricted areas.
For example, an employee logging in from within a pre-approved country can proceed without interruptions, but someone attempting access from a flagged region might trigger additional checks or be stopped completely.
Why Combine Region-Aware Access with Step-Up Authentication?
Step-up authentication comes into play when additional verification is required based on specific risk factors—like suspicious logins or activity from geo-restricted areas. Bundling this with region-aware access means your system can make real-time decisions to enforce stronger security policies only when necessary.
How It Works:
- Initial Check: Upon login, the system evaluates the user’s geographic location, using data like their IP address.
- Access Decision: Based on predefined rules (e.g., location whitelists or blacklists), the system decides:
- Allow standard login for low-risk areas.
- Require step-up authentication (like MFA) for high-risk regions.
- Completely block access if a region is blacklisted.
- Adapt to Risk Levels: Users logging in from unexpected or unauthorized regions are either denied access or challenged with additional security steps.
Key Benefits of Adding Region-Aware Step-Up Authentication
- Context-Specific Security
Not all risks are created equal. Region-aware access paired with step-up authentication ensures that higher risk logins are addressed without disrupting regular, low-risk ones. - Minimized User Friction
You don’t need to overwhelm all users with multi-factor verification. Instead, this approach secures systems in higher-risk contexts while streamlining the experience for trustworthy users. - Enhanced Control with Simple Configuration
Administrators can define region-based security policies tailored to their organization’s specific needs. - Regulatory Compliance
Many industries require strict location-based access controls (e.g., GDPR, HIPAA). Implementing this ensures you meet territorial data protection rules.
Steps to Implement Region-Aware Step-Up Authentication
1. Define Region Policies
- Identify safe, restricted, and high-risk areas based on your organization’s global operations and risk assessment.
- Clearly map out the rules: where logins can be allowed, where step-up should occur, and what regions are entirely off-limits.
2. Set Up Location-Based Rules
Use user IP addresses to dynamically determine login policies. For better accuracy, integrate geolocation APIs to map real-world locations dynamically.
3. Add Conditional Triggers for Step-Up
Enforce multi-factor authentication only for specific conditions:
- Access requests from outside approved regions.
- Suspicious activity or attempted repeated logins from flagged locations.
- Regions with known security risks or compliance limits.
4. Test and Monitor
Before rolling this out broadly, test these policies in action. Monitor user activity and iteratively improve alarm thresholds to reduce false positives.
See it in Action with Hoop.dev
Configuring and maintaining region-aware access controls paired with step-up authentication can seem daunting, but it doesn’t have to be. With Hoop.dev, you can implement these advanced policies in minutes—ensuring global security without adding unnecessary complexity to your infrastructure. See how easy it is to create, test, and apply region-aware rules by exploring Hoop.dev today.
Don’t take our word for it, experience secure simplicity firsthand. Try Hoop.dev free and secure your users smarter.